Engaging Indoor Activities for Families

1. Explore Interactive Museums

Chattanooga boasts several interactive museums that cater to children and families, making them perfect for rainy day adventures.

Located in Downtown Chattanooga, this museum is designed for children from birth to age 12. It features hands-on exhibits that encourage creativity and learning through play. Kids can explore everything from a water play area to an art studio where they can unleash their artistic talents.

While it may not be entirely indoors, the Tennessee Aquarium offers indoor exhibits that are perfect for rainy weather. Families can marvel at a variety of aquatic life and learn about ecosystems. The River Journey and Ocean Journey buildings provide an immersive experience that captivates visitors of all ages.

Dive into Chattanooga’s rich history at this engaging museum. The exhibits are designed to be interactive, allowing children to learn about the city’s past while having fun. You can also find special programs and activities tailored for families.

2. Indoor Play Spaces

When the weather outside is dreary, indoor play spaces can be a lifesaver for families with energetic kids.

This indoor playground in the Southside neighborhood offers a safe, fun environment for kids to climb, slide, and play. With a variety of play structures and areas specifically designed for different age groups, children can burn off energy while parents relax.

Located in the North Shore area, Jump Park is an indoor trampoline park that provides a unique way for kids to stay active despite the rain. With trampolines, foam pits, and dodgeball courts, it’s an exciting option for families looking for a little adventure.

This indoor amusement center features arcade games, laser tag, and mini-golf. Located in Downtown Chattanooga, it offers a variety of activities that cater to families, making it a great spot for a day of fun.

4. Movie Theaters and Entertainment Venues

Sometimes, the best way to spend a rainy day is to relax and enjoy a good movie. Chattanooga has several theaters that cater to families.

Known for its stunning architecture, the Tivoli Theatre often hosts family-friendly films and performances. Check their schedule for special movie nights or events that the whole family can enjoy.

This modern movie theater offers a variety of films, including the latest family-friendly releases. With comfortable seating and a range of snack options, it's an excellent way to escape the rain for a few hours.

For families with older kids, consider attending a family-friendly improv show. Chattanooga Improv offers performances that are suitable for all ages, providing laughter and entertainment on a rainy day.

Neighborhood Breakdown

Southside

The Southside neighborhood is home to several engaging indoor activities. Families can visit the Creative Discovery Museum for hands-on learning or enjoy a fun-filled day at The Play Space. Additionally, the area features a variety of restaurants and cafes for a cozy meal after your adventures.

Downtown

Downtown Chattanooga is a hub for indoor activities. The Tennessee Aquarium is a must-visit, and families can also explore the Chattanooga History Center for a dose of local history. After a day of exploration, families can unwind at one of the many eateries in the area.

St. Elmo

In St. Elmo, families can take part in art workshops at local studios. The neighborhood's community vibe makes it a great spot for creative activities, and there are often family-oriented events happening throughout the year.

North Shore

North Shore is where you'll find Jump Park, an excellent venue for active kids. The neighborhood also offers scenic views of the river, making it a pleasant place to walk around before or after your indoor activities.

Highland Park

Highland Park offers a variety of creative workshops, including those at The Clay Pot. Families can enjoy a day of crafting and learning together while exploring the artistic side of Chattanooga.

Overall, each neighborhood provides unique opportunities for families to enjoy their time indoors, ensuring that rainy days can still be filled with fun and engaging activities.
